Struct vulkanalia::vk::MicromapTriangleEXTBuilder
source · #[repr(transparent)]pub struct MicromapTriangleEXTBuilder { /* private fields */ }
Expand description
A builder for a MicromapTriangleEXT
.
Implementations§
source§impl MicromapTriangleEXTBuilder
impl MicromapTriangleEXTBuilder
pub fn data_offset(self, data_offset: u32) -> Self
pub fn subdivision_level(self, subdivision_level: u16) -> Self
pub fn format(self, format: u16) -> Self
pub fn build(self) -> MicromapTriangleEXT
Trait Implementations§
source§impl Cast for MicromapTriangleEXTBuilder
impl Cast for MicromapTriangleEXTBuilder
§type Target = MicromapTriangleEXT
type Target = MicromapTriangleEXT
The other type this type can be used interchangeably with in FFI.
source§impl Clone for MicromapTriangleEXTBuilder
impl Clone for MicromapTriangleEXTBuilder
source§fn clone(&self) -> MicromapTriangleEXTBuilder
fn clone(&self) -> MicromapTriangleEXTBuilder
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for MicromapTriangleEXTBuilder
impl Debug for MicromapTriangleEXTBuilder
source§impl Default for MicromapTriangleEXTBuilder
impl Default for MicromapTriangleEXTBuilder
source§fn default() -> MicromapTriangleEXTBuilder
fn default() -> MicromapTriangleEXTBuilder
Returns the “default value” for a type. Read more
source§impl Deref for MicromapTriangleEXTBuilder
impl Deref for MicromapTriangleEXTBuilder
impl Copy for MicromapTriangleEXTBuilder
Auto Trait Implementations§
impl RefUnwindSafe for MicromapTriangleEXTBuilder
impl Send for MicromapTriangleEXTBuilder
impl Sync for MicromapTriangleEXTBuilder
impl Unpin for MicromapTriangleEXTBuilder
impl UnwindSafe for MicromapTriangleEXTBuilder
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more